随着加密货币市场的不断成长,虚拟币钱包成为了数字资产管理的必备工具。选择一个合适的虚拟币钱包,不仅可以...
随着区块链技术的快速发展,区块链钱包的需求也越来越大。尤其是在数字货币的投资者和用户中,了解如何安装和使用区块链钱包源码,成为了不可或缺的一部分。本文将详细介绍区块链钱包的原理、源码的获取方式、具体的安装步骤,以及一些常见的问题和关键点,希望能帮助到所有对区块链技术感兴趣的朋友。
区块链钱包是一个数字钱包,用于存储和管理区块链网络上的加密货币。这些钱包可以是软件程序、移动应用,甚至是硬件设备,它们的核心功能是允许用户接收、存储和发送数字货币。了解区块链钱包的基本原理,为后续获取和实现源码安装打下基础。
区块链钱包分为热钱包和冷钱包两类。热钱包连接互联网,易于使用,但安全性相对较低;而冷钱包则是离线存储,虽然使用不便,但安全性高。无论是哪种钱包,它们都通过公钥和私钥系统确保交易的安全性。公钥如同你的银行账户号码,可以公开分享,而私钥则是你访问和操作数字资产的密码,必须妥善保管。
获取区块链钱包的源码是构建您自己钱包应用的第一步。您可以通过几个途径获得所需的源码:
首先,开源社区是一个不错的资源。GitHub上有大量的开源区块链钱包项目,您可以直接Clone或者下载相关的项目。例如,Bitcoin的官方钱包、以太坊钱包(Mist)等都可以在GitHub上找到。这些项目一般提供详细的文档和使用说明,使得您能够在较短时间内上手。
其次,可以在一些技术论坛上找到开发者分享的源码。在区块链技术相关的论坛和社群中,活跃的开发者会分享他们的项目,您可以在这些地方找到适合的源码。
还有一些在线平台专注于提供区块链技术的各种工具和源码。通过搜索引擎,您可以轻松找到这些平台。请务必注意,尽量选择社区活跃并且信誉良好的来源,以避免安全隐患。
在您获取到区块链钱包的源码后,下面是一些基本的安装步骤,供您参考:
步骤一:**设置开发环境**
首先,确保您的计算机上安装了相关的开发环境。例如,如果是使用JavaScript的区块链钱包,需要Node.js和npm;使用Python的则需要安装Python环境等。
步骤二:**克隆源码**
使用Git命令将远程的源码克隆到您的本地. 您可以在终端运行以下命令:`git clone
步骤三:**安装依赖**
进入到克隆下来的文件夹中,阅读项目文档,安装相应的依赖包。一般在项目根目录下运行`npm install`(对于Node.js项目)或使用其他相应的指令。
步骤四:**配置和编译**
根据需要配置环境参数,如API密钥、安全证书等信息。然后,编译项目,通常是在终端输入`npm run build`等命令,这样可以将源码转化为可执行文件。
步骤五:**运行应用**
执行编译好的文件,启动钱包应用。之后,您可以根据引导进行注册或创建新的钱包。
在安装和使用区块链钱包时,安全性是一个不可或缺的重要考量。无论是开发还是使用钱包,确保资金和数据的安全都是至关重要的。以下是一些推荐的安全措施:
首先,确保你下载的钱包源码来自于官方或可信的开源社区。一定要仔细检查代码库的活跃程度、用户评论和开发者的信誉,选择一些历史悠久、维护良好的项目。
其次,在使用钱包时务必妥善保存私钥。私钥是访问你数字资产的唯一钥匙,任何获取到您私钥的人都可以完全操纵您的资产。因此,不要轻易分享私钥,最好将其保存在离线环境中,如密码本或加密的USB存储设备上。
另外,考虑使用多重签名钱包,以提高安全性。多重签名钱包需要多个私钥才能进行交易,这可以在多个设备或用户间分散风险,有效防止单点故障。
最重要的是,定期更新您钱包应用的版本,确保使用到最新的功能和安全修复。开发者会不断修正漏洞,提升应用的安全性,所以保持更新是至关重要的。
公钥和私钥是区块链钱包的核心。在数字钱包中,公钥就像一个对外的账户名,用户可以安全地将其提供给其他人供他们发送加密货币。而私钥则是保密的,用户必须妥善保管。未授权的人获得私钥,即可完全控制与之对应的资金。因此,公钥可以自由分享以方便交易,而私钥则必须严格保护,不可泄露。
保障区块链钱包的安全性可以从多个方面入手。首先,使用强密码和双因素认证保护账户。多数钱包应用都支持额外的认证手段,增加安全性。同时,尽量选择信誉良好、经过审核的钱包软件,不要使用未经验证的应用。此外,定期备份钱包信息,以防意外丢失导致资金损失。
监控区块链钱包可以通过使用区块链浏览器,输入钱包地址即可查看其交易记录和余额。同时,许多钱包应用也配备了相关监控工具,可以实时显示交易状态。对于大型投资者来说,设置警报通知,实时掌握资产变动也是非常必要的。
选择合适的区块链钱包需要考虑多种因素,包括安全性、用户体验、支持的币种、备份和恢复功能等。最好选择那些支持多种加密货币、用户评价好的钱包。此外,考虑钱包的开源程度也是一项关键因素。了解其开发团队背景,以及用户的真实性反馈,可以帮助您做出更合理的选择。
如果您发现您的钱包被盗,第一步是立即转移剩余的资金到另一个安全的钱包中。接着,查看钱包应用的安全建议,确保您没有遗漏任何安全措施。如果可能,您可以联系钱包提供商,他们可能会有相应的措施和建议。在此之前,请务必分析问题出在何处,以防再次发生。
总结来说,区块链钱包的源码下载与安装,为用户提供了更多自主选择和控制的空间,同时也提出了更高的安全性要求。掌握区块链钱包的使用,不仅是对个人资产安全的保护,更是参与到区块链世界的关键一步。希望通过本文的详细讲解,帮助到想要深入了解和使用区块链技术的朋友们。